Brazil ranks among the top five global markets for beauty and personal care products. The domestic market, driven by heavy cultural consumption of hair care, fragrance, and premium skincare, demands massive quantities of glass containers. However, the local Brazilian glass manufacturing sector faces complex production challenges, including high energy tariffs, localized raw material cost fluctuations, and highly consolidated domestic suppliers focusing primarily on large-volume beverage markets rather than specialized cosmetic containers.
For Brazilian cosmetic brands located in regions like São Paulo, Curitiba, and Rio de Janeiro, sourcing premium glass packaging locally presents major bottlenecks:

As part of Lecos Glass's long-term design goals, we continuously innovate our manufacturing lines to optimize weight, structural integrity, and eco-friendliness. Key areas of technological focus include:
Traditional cosmetic packaging relies heavily on thick-bottomed glass designs to imply luxury weight. However, international air and sea freight logistics require reduction in overall weight to minimize fuel emissions. Through finite element analysis (FEA) and modernized molding techniques, we can produce high-strength, thin-walled glass that matches the structural drop resistance of traditional thick glass, reducing cargo carbon footprint by up to 25% for Brazilian importers.
We actively test and scale Post-Consumer Recycled (PCR) glass integrations. While cosmetic packaging demands pristine optical clarity, we offer varying percentages of PCR glass (up to 40%) that retain extreme transparency while satisfying environmental packaging mandates. This aligns directly with the environmental consciousness of Brazilian consumers, who increasingly prefer sustainable beauty solutions.
International cosmetic regulations require packaging to contain virtually zero heavy metals. Lecos Glass utilizes exclusively heavy-metal-free inorganic paints and lead-free glass formulations. This ensures that every shipment entering Brazilian ports complies immediately with local ANVISA testing standards, preventing customs rejection risks.

Operating a modernized, automated manufacturing plant in China allows Lecos Glass to achieve levels of scalability and precision that are difficult to replicate in local regional hubs. By leveraging automatic optical inspection systems (AOIs) and automated line packaging, we guarantee that critical dimensions (such as bottleneck inner/outer diameters and screw thread tolerances) remain virtually deviation-free.
This precision is critical for the cosmetics industry: even a 0.2mm deviation in the neck of a dropper bottle can result in product leakage during transit or pressure drops inside airplanes. Our strict quality control systems eliminate these risks, ensuring reliable, high-performing cosmetic containers.
